Output 08477084c375150143b5d330d951b6dde985204dc22fc40fdd4e3a82006a509a:5

value
656242
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ce8ccf44d7cdb64b6c411893c681bc1ea0069e9 OP_EQUALVERIFY OP_CHECKSIG
address
181fErDZuJpTkYszqyANk74cyEWky38FMG
transaction
08477084c375150143b5d330d951b6dde985204dc22fc40fdd4e3a82006a509a
spent
true